A YouGov poll shows that 53% of UK respondents believe the British Museum should have a permanent exhibition on the transatlantic slave trade. Two-thirds agree on the museum's responsibility to educate the public about the UK's role in slavery. The letter sent to the museum's director emphasizes the need for such an exhibit, while a second letter to the UK Culture Secretary highlights the importance of acknowledging this history during the museum's renovation. Additionally, a memorial artwork titled 'The Wake' will be established in London to honor victims of transatlantic slavery. Teljes cikk (Euronews.com)
